Air-Fryer Chicken Pesto Stuffed Peppers

On busy weeknights, I don’t want to spend more than 30 minutes preparing dinner, nor do I want to wash a towering pile of dishes. These air-fryer stuffed peppers deliver without having to sacrifice flavor! —Olivia Cruz, Greenville, South Carolina
  • Total Time
    Prep/Total Time: 25 min.
  • Makes
    4 servings

Ingredients

  • 4 medium sweet yellow or orange peppers
  • 1-1/2 cups shredded rotisserie chicken
  • 1-1/2 cups cooked brown rice
  • 1 cup prepared pesto
  • 1/2 cup shredded Havarti cheese
  • Fresh basil leaves, optional

Directions

  • Preheat air fryer to 400°. Cut peppers lengthwise in half; remove stems and seeds. In batches, place peppers in a single layer on tray in air-fryer basket. Cook until skin starts to blister and peppers are just tender, 10-15 minutes. Reduce air fryer temperature to 350°.
  • Meanwhile, in a large bowl, combine chicken, rice and pesto. When cool enough to handle, fill peppers with chicken mixture. In batches, cook until heated through, about 5 minutes. Sprinkle with cheese; cook until cheese is melted, 3-5 minutes. If desired, sprinkle with basil.
Nutrition Facts
2 stuffed pepper halves: 521 calories, 31g fat (7g saturated fat), 62mg cholesterol, 865mg sodium, 33g carbohydrate (7g sugars, 5g fiber), 25g protein.
